( pull 5651, Woodstox implementation, StAX API, Azure Artifact Manager plugin, Azure Container Agents plugin, Azure Storage plugin, Azure SDK API plugin, Jackson 2 API plugin) Plugins that consume Woodstox should depend on it directly or via the Jackson 2 API plugin. Users of the Azure Artifact Manager, Azure Container Agents, Azure Storage, and Azure SDK API plugins must upgrade those plugins to the latest versions in lockstep with this core upgrade. Remove the Woodstox implementation of the StAX API from Jenkins core. Load classes from plugins in parallel for faster startup on multicore machines. Docker Slaves plugin is incompatible with this change.

( Upgrade guide - Built-In Node Name and Label Migration) If a job definition, Pipeline definition, or tool installer reference must be tied to the built-in node, it should use the label " built-in". NODE_NAME environment variable) or label of the built-in node until an administrator explicitly performs the migration. New installations get the new node and label immediately.Įxisting installations do not change the node name (e.g. Replace the term "master" for the main Jenkins application with "controller" or "built-in node" in user interface strings and documentation.
